Settling Foundation Service in East Longmeadow, MA
Settling foundation services address issues where the ground beneath a property shifts or sinks, causing structural movement and unevenness.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the settlement, stabilizing the foundation, and restoring proper alignment to ensure safety and stability. Projects often include lifting or leveling uneven floors, repairing cracks in walls or ceilings, and reinforcing the foundation to prevent further movement. Homeowners considering this service should understand the specific signs of foundation settlement, such as c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and uneven flooring, to determine if intervention is necessary.
Before requesting settlement foundation services, property owners usually want to know the scope of the work involved, the methods used to stabilize the foundation, and any potential impacts on their property during the process. It is also helpful to understand the causes of foundation settlement, such as soil conditions or moisture changes, to address underlying issues. Common Settling Foundation Service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- methods to prevent shifting and protect the structure’s integrity.
Pier and Beam Repair - addressing issues with support beams and piers to ensure stability.
Slab Leveling - raising and leveling uneven concrete slabs to eliminate tripping hazards.
Basement Underpinning - strengthening and stabilizing basement floors affected by settlement.
Crack Repair - sealing fo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Settlement Assessment - evaluating signs of uneven settling to determine appropriate corrective measures.
Settling Foundation Service Questions
What are signs of foundation settling? Common sign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, and sticking doors or windows.
Can settling foundations affect property value? Yes, foundation issues can impact the value and require repairs to maintain property worth.
What causes foundation settling? Factors such as soil movement, moisture changes, and poor initial construction can lead to settling.
How is settling foundation repair typically performed? Repairs often involve underpinning or stabilization methods to restore foundation integrity and prevent further movement.
